Finally got the chance to check this place out on a Saturday at around 12:45. It wasn’t too busy but service was a bit slow since the poor bartender was doing double duty making drinks and serving food.

We ordered two pizzas between me and my husband, which was really ambitious because we probably ate like 1.5 slices each and we were already stuffed. The pies are pretty heavy so I would probably only recommend getting more than one if you have at least 4 people. We had leftovers for days, which I normally wouldn’t be mad at pizza leftovers but we literally ate this for at least 4-5 more meals and at that point, it’s a chore (but I’m also not one to let pizza go to waste).

The two pies we chose were the Earth First (crimini mushroom, shiitake mushroom, caramelized onion, ricotta, truffle oil, and parsley) and the Thuper Thupreme (sweet sausage meatballs, pepperoni, spicy sausage, mushrooms, onions, green peppers, olives, marinara, and oregano). Both were great and so cheesy, with the cheese pushed to the edge, making it super crispy, as a Detroit pizza should be. But like I said, one slice is already really filling. Definitely not something you would want to eat too often.

This place is amazing. Great food and great cocktails. Cool decor when you walk in. They have pin ball machine backs hanging up in some spots which is cool. It would be even cooler if they had a pin ball machine. But anyway this place is still awesome. Filling up at 530 on a Saturday and an hour later it was filled. A big party in the front as well.

Staff were extremely friendly and approached us right away asking were we wanted to sit.

Each cocktail we got was excellent and worth the $14. My husband got the notorious FIG and it was delicious. You could actually taste both the fig and cocoa. It was so good. I got the hitching a ride which had pineapple flavors and made me feel like I was on an island.

We shared one pizza. 6 slices per pizza and I thought 1 pizza was enough to share. It was thick and crispy and gooey. We got the motor city which is a pepperoni pizza. It comes with hot honey on the side. It’s spicy as is with the pepperoni so I didn’t use too much of the hot honey, but it was very good. The only other Detroit style pizza I have tried was Emily squared. And this place is much better!! At least in my opinion. Apparently this place had been open for 5 years and I had no idea!
